headmaster
英 [ˌhedˈmɑːstə(r)]
美 [ˌhedˈmæstər]
n. (尤指私立学校的)校长
复数:headmasters
Collins.1 / BNC.4787 / COCA.16726
牛津词典
noun
- (尤指私立学校的)校长
a teacher who is in charge of a school, especially a private school
柯林斯词典
- (中小学的)男校长
Aheadmasteris a man who is the head teacher of a school.
英英释义
noun
- presiding officer of a school
